Overview

Polymer blends are the mixture of two or more polymers in order to obtain new materials with improved properties. Polymer blends can be used to improve properties such as toughness, flexibility, strength, chemical resistance, and thermal behavior, as well as for the reduction of costs. They are used in a variety of industries, including chemical, automotive, food, and biomedical applications. Polymer blends are increasingly gaining attention in the scientific community, as they have the potential to improve materials in a wide range of applications.
